Sir Ernest Shackleton
• Born February 14th, 1874
• Came from a middle class background, the
son of a moderately successful physician.
• Joined the British Merchant Navy at age 16.
• This was Shackelton’s third expedition to
Antarctica. His first was in 1901 as a
member of the National Antarctic
Expedition led by Robert S. Scott, a British
explorer
• In 1907, Shackelton led the first expedition,
with his goal to reach the pole. He had
three companions but ended up having to
turn back because of food shortage.
• Married a daughter of a wealthy lawyer.
• Leader of the expedition
• Died January 5th, 1922.
